General

This is a full-time, FLSA, exempt, position responsible for the day‐to‐day administering of aircraft and engine records as required by company policy and/ or FAA regulations. The Aircraft Technical Records Specialist oversees and is responsible for the accuracy, completeness, and compliance of the company’s aircraft records and is responsible for ensuring the high integrity and dependability of all aircraft records and maintenance information.

Duties and Responsibilities

The Aircraft Technical Records Specialist reports to the Manager of Aircraft Technical Records with the following duties and responsibilities:

Maintains strict compliance with FAA regulations and company requirements of all aircraft records using company database and tracking systems;

Monitors and resolves all daily aircraft maintenance discrepancies and work package data;

Oversees the dependability and reliability of aircraft records and time control systems on life-limited components and aircraft maintenance services;

Ensures the department and/or records are maintained in an organized file for each aircraft’s permanent records, creating new files as needed;

Periodically audits aircraft and engine records to ensure the accuracy of components scheduled and subsequently confirms or corrects entries made as needed;

Ensures that all accomplished scheduled maintenance forms, Airworthiness Directives (ADs), and Service Bulletins (SBs), are properly recorded in the permanent aircraft log;

Develop new processes and procedures and/or implement changes to existing work processes and procedures for a more efficient work environment.

Follows processes and procedures used by the department in the procurement and reception of aircraft parts will guard against “unapproved” parts from entering the parts system and to ensure that any such parts are detected before their use;

Periodically audits to ensure that a current record of inspections and tests is maintained on all inspection tools and the calibration of precision test equipment used by mechanics.
